Title of article :
Nanostructured platinum-on-carbon model electrocatalysts prepared by colloidal lithography

Abstract :
We describe the preparation of novel, nanostructured model catalysts for electrocatalytic studies, consisting of Pt nanoparticles with well-defined particle size and separation supported on glassy carbon. The model catalysts are fabricated by colloidal lithography (CL) and characterized with respect to their morphology and their electrochemical and electrocatalytic properties by scanning electron microscopy, atomic force microscopy, X-ray photoelectron spectroscopy, cyclic voltammetry and CO electrooxidation. The resulting data – with comparatively large particles – closely resemble those obtained on polycrystalline Pt electrodes, demonstrating that CL is a viable method for the preparation of well-defined model systems with successively smaller structures for electrocatalytic studies.
